Output 31fb562725012d29d8aa233b7ad85c03e1a11a9877be3e05b6de8d92f1a9f65c:3

value
36960
script pubkey
OP_0 OP_PUSHBYTES_20 cde4e5b4f6cb73d005a0660eb73c569ac8ec3bc9
address
bc1qehjwtd8kedeaqpdqvc8tw0zkntywcw7fhfqkfd
transaction
31fb562725012d29d8aa233b7ad85c03e1a11a9877be3e05b6de8d92f1a9f65c
confirmations
62690
spent
true